Tony and Steve enter into a partnership by investing Rs.14000 and Rs. 16000 respectively. After 8 months, Thor joins them with a capital of Rs.12000. Find the share of Thor in a total profit of Rs. 57000 after 2 years?
Solution
The profit share in a partnership is divided according to the capital invested and the time period for which the capital was invested.
First, we need to calculate the capital for the time period for each person.
For Tony, the capital for the time period is Rs.14000 * 24 months = Rs.336000 For Steve, the capital for the time period is Rs.16000 * 24 months = Rs.384000 For Thor, the capital for the time period is Rs.12000 * 16 months (since Thor joined after 8 months) = Rs.192000
The total capital for the time period is Rs.336000 + Rs.384000 + Rs.192000 = Rs.912000
Now, we can calculate the share of each person in the total profit.
The share of Thor in the total profit is (Thor's capital for the time period / total capital for the time period) * total profit = (Rs.192000 / Rs.912000) * Rs.57000 = Rs.12000
So, Thor's share in the total profit of Rs.57000 after 2 years is Rs.12000.
